OPERATIVE TO-DAY

(Britiah Official Wireless.)

Angio-Canadian Trade Treaty

RUGBY Aug. 31. ' The trade agreement between Britain nnd Canada which was signed in February comes into operation to-morrow. The new treaty secures free entry into Canada of about 30 per ■ cent. of imports from Britain and lower duties on goods accounting for about 40 per cent. by valuo of tho total imports of United Kingdom goods, including woollou and cotton textiles. There are also clauses to protcet consumers against exploitation and to prcvent dumping.
